I've started testing the upgrade from 7.7.1908 to 7.8.2003 using CR 
repository, and I've found a little dependency issue. I hope this is the 
right place to report it, otherwise please point me to right direction.

We have have a bunch of machines with the following packages installed:
- sclo-php72-php-pecl-imagick-3.4.4-1.el7.x86_64
- sclo-php73-php-pecl-imagick-3.4.4-2.el7.x86_64

When updating with cr repository yum complains about ImageMagick (the 
same error applies also to php73):

Error: Package: sclo-php72-php-pecl-imagick-3.4.4-1.el7.x86_64 
(@centos-sclo-sclo)
            Requires: libMagickWand.so.5()(64bit)
            Removing: ImageMagick-6.7.8.9-18.el7.x86_64 (@base)
                libMagickWand.so.5()(64bit)
            Updated By: ImageMagick-6.9.10.68-3.el7.x86_64 (cr)
                Not found

Maybe it's a just a matter to recompile the RPM with the new ImageMagick 
release?
